Mom's Excellent Chocolate Chip Cookies

Original recipe yield 2 dozen

INGREDIENTS (Nutrition)

  • 1/2 cup butter, softened
  • 1/2 cup butter flavored shortening
  • 1/2 cup white sugar
  • 1/2 cup packed brown sugar
  • 1 eg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 cup sifted all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up semisweet chocolate chips
  • 1/2 cup chopped walnuts

DIRECTIONS

  1.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Grease cookie sheets.
  2. Cream butter, shortening, both sugars, egg, and vanilla in an electric mixer until fluffy.
  3. Stir in sifted dry ingredients.
  4. Add chocolate chips and walnuts.
  5. Drop by teaspoonfuls, 2 inches apart onto greased cookie sheet. Bake for 10-12 minutes or until golden.
